Fat Loss vs. Weight Loss: Which Path is Right for Your Goal?
The first critical decision on your fitness journey is understanding this distinction: Weight Loss is any decrease in the number on the scale, which can come from water, muscle, or fat. Fat Loss is the targeted reduction of unhealthy body fat while actively preserving or even building metabolically active lean muscle tissue. For most people seeking a transformation, fat loss is the undisputed winner. Losing muscle sacrifices your strength, slows your metabolism, and often leaves you looking “skinny fat”—softer and less healthy than before. Preserving muscle, however, ensures you become leaner, stronger, and more energetic, with a metabolism primed to keep the fat off for good.
